    What Is Cryptocurrency Technology?

    Cryptocurrency technology refers to the digital systems that make virtual currencies secure, decentralized, and transparent. At its core lies blockchain technology — a distributed ledger that records every transaction across a network of computers.

    Unlike traditional banks, cryptocurrency systems don’t depend on a central authority. Instead, they use:

    • Cryptography for security
    • Consensus algorithms for trust
    • Decentralized networks for transparency

    Together, these elements enable cryptocurrencies to operate freely — without banks, governments, or middlemen.

    Core Components of Cryptocurrency Technology

    1. Blockchain Technology

    The blockchain is the backbone of cryptocurrency. It’s a digital chain of blocks, each containing transaction data, timestamps, and cryptographic signatures. Once added to the chain, data cannot be changed — ensuring transparency and security.

    .2. Cryptography

    Cryptography secures every cryptocurrency transaction. It uses complex mathematical algorithms to encrypt and verify data, making it nearly impossible for hackers to alter transactions.

    Two main types of cryptography include:

    • Public-key cryptography: Each user has a public and private key.
    • Hash functions: Used to create unique digital signatures for each transaction.

    3. Decentralization

    Unlike traditional financial systems controlled by central authorities, cryptocurrencies rely on decentralized networks.

    Every transaction is verified by thousands of computers (called nodes) worldwide.
    This ensures:

    • No single point of failure
    • Increased transparency
    • Greater security
    • Freedom from government control

    4. Consensus Mechanisms

    To keep networks synchronized and trustworthy, cryptocurrencies use consensus algorithms that validate transactions.

    The two most common are:

    • Proof of Work (PoW): Used by Bitcoin, requiring miners to solve complex puzzles.
    • Proof of Stake (PoS): Used by Ethereum 2.0 and Cardano, allowing users to stake coins for validation.

    These systems prevent fraud and ensure all participants agree on the same record.

    5. Smart Contracts

    A major innovation in cryptocurrency technology is the smart contract — a self-executing agreement built on blockchain. Smart contracts automatically execute actions when specific conditions are met, eliminating the need for third parties. For example, when buying an NFT, ownership transfers automatically after payment.

    How Cryptocurrency Technology Works

    Here’s how a typical crypto transaction happens:

    1. A user sends a transaction request (e.g., sending Bitcoin).
    2. The transaction is verified by blockchain nodes.
    3. Verified data is grouped into a block.
    4. The block is permanently added to the blockchain.
    5. The recipient receives the cryptocurrency securely.

    This process occurs within seconds and is recorded publicly, ensuring complete transparency and immutability.

    Real-World Applications of Cryptocurrency Technology

    Cryptocurrency technology goes far beyond digital payments. It’s transforming entire industries:

    • Finance (DeFi): Enables peer-to-peer lending, borrowing, and trading without banks.
    • Supply Chain Management: Tracks goods and verifies authenticity.
    • Healthcare: Protects patient records using encrypted blockchain systems.
    • Gaming (Play-to-Earn): Rewards players with crypto for achievements.
    • NFTs: Enable digital ownership of art, music, and collectibles.
    • Cross-Border Payments: Offer faster, cheaper, and borderless money transfers.

    These applications show how cryptocurrency technology is redefining trust, ownership, and global transactions.

    Advantages of Cryptocurrency Technology

    • Transparency: Every transaction is publicly recorded.
    • Security: Strong encryption prevents fraud and tampering.
    • Decentralization: Eliminates the need for intermediaries.
    • Low Fees: Reduces transaction costs.
    • Global Access: Available to anyone with an internet connection.
    • Innovation: Supports DApps, NFTs, and smart contracts.

    Challenges and Limitations

    Despite its potential, cryptocurrency technology faces a few challenges:

    • Scalability: Some blockchains can’t handle large transaction volumes.
    • Energy Use: Mining (PoW) consumes significant electricity.
    • Security Risks: Exchanges and wallets can be hacked if poorly secured.
    • Regulatory Uncertainty: Governments are still creating crypto laws.
    • Price Volatility: Crypto prices often fluctuate sharply.

    Solving these challenges will be key to cryptocurrency’s long-term success.
